美文网首页
第五章 与HTTP协作的Web服务器

第五章 与HTTP协作的Web服务器

作者: 飘摇的水草 | 来源:发表于2022-07-14 16:43 被阅读0次
5.1 用单台虚拟主机实现多个域名

HTTP/1.1 规范允许一台 HTTP 服务器搭建多个 Web 站点。这是因为利用了虚拟主机(Virtual Host,又称虚拟服务器)的功能。即使物理层面只有一台服务器,但只要使用虚拟主机的功能,则可以假想已具有多台服务器。

在相同的 IP 地址下,由于虚拟主机可以寄存多个不同主机名和域名 的 Web 网站,因此在发送 HTTP 请求时,必须在 Host 首部内完整指 定主机名或域名的 URI。

5.2 隧道

隧道可按要求建立起一条与其他服务器的通信线路,届时使用 SSL 等 加密手段进行通信。隧道的目的是确保客户端能与服务器进行安全的通信。隧道本身不会去解析 HTTP 请求。也就是说,请求保持原样中转给之 后的服务器。隧道会在通信双方断开连接时结束。

相关文章

  • HTTP学习笔记#2

    五、与HTTP协作的web服务器 HTTP/1.1 规范允许一台HTTP服务器搭建多个web站点,即在相同IP地址...

  • 「 图解HTTP 」 读书笔记 第五章

    与 HTTP 协作的 Web 服务器 一台 Web 服务器可搭建多个独立域名的 Web 网站,也可作为通信路径上的...

  • 图解HTTP--笔记3

    与 HTTP 协作的 Web 服务器 一台 Web 服务器可搭建多个独立域名的 Web 网站,也可作为通信路径上的...

  • 与http协作web服务器

    利用单台虚拟主机实现多个域名 在一台物理主机上,可以实现多个虚拟服务器,它们可以运行各自不同的网站。当客户端发送一...

  • 图解HTTP协议读书笔记五

    图解HTTP协议读书笔记五 与http协议协作的web服务器 1.1 用单台虚拟主机实现多个域名 HTTP/1.1...

  • 与HTTP协作的Web服务器

    虚拟主机 访问虚拟机主机时,由于是同一台物理机,所以ip是一样的,需要在Host首部完整指定主机名或域...

  • 与HTTP协作的Web服务器

    用单台虚拟主机实现多个域名   HTTP/1.1规范允许一台HTTP服务器搭建多个Web站点。比如,提供Web托管...

  • 与HTTP协作的Web服务器

    用单台虚拟主体实现多个域名物理层面只有一台服务器,但只要使用虚拟主机的功能,则可以假想具备多台服务器 通信数据转发...

  • 《图解HTTP》- Web 服务器 - 学习笔记(三)

    第5章 与 HTTP 协作的 Web 服务器 5.1 用单台虚拟主机实现多个域名 HTTP/1.1 规范允许一台 ...

  • 第五章 与HTTP协作的Web服务器

    5.1 用单台虚拟主机实现多个域名 HTTP/1.1 规范允许一台 HTTP 服务器搭建多个 Web 站点。这是因...

网友评论

      本文标题:第五章 与HTTP协作的Web服务器

      本文链接:https://www.haomeiwen.com/subject/rwixirtx.html